Large number of copy and verification errors in LTO using PreRoll Post
Hi All,
Following your responses to my questions in a previous thread, I decided to go with a Quantum LTO-7 drive (using LTO-6 tapes until the v7 media cost comes down) and PreRoll Post to back up my footage for a shoot in which we’re generating ~8TB a day of 4K ProRes. The footage is getting offloaded to a large RAID6 volume and, in theory at least, backed up to LTO-6 tapes.
However, we’ve been having a number of problems — first, we’re getting a large number of copy and verification errors in the PreRoll Post backup sessions. I’m new to LTO backup, so am confused. Is it normal to have copy and verification errors when writing to LTO? We’re talking in the range of 1-3 copy errors and 2-6 checksum errors per tape, consistently across now a half dozen attempts.
Second, when attempting spanned backups (e.x. ~4.5TB, so 2 tapes), PreRoll Post gets to the end of the first tape, reports the copy and checksum errors, and asks for another tape to complete the backup. However, I can’t get it to eject the first tape. The communication log in PRP says “resource busy, try ‘diskutil unmount,'” but diskutil unmount returns a ‘disk in use’ message and won’t unmount the tape. The only way out is to cancel the backup, restart PRP, and then unmount the tape, but of course at that point there’s no way to resume the backup. In each backup attempt we’ve formatted a fresh HP LTO-6 Ultrium tape in the PreRoll Post settings menu before starting the backup.

My system:
Brand new Quantum LTO-7 drive in a rack mount enclosure, operating over SAS through a HighPoint RocketStor 6328. This is running into a 6-core late 2013 Mac Pro with 64GB RAM running OSX 10.11.4. We’re pulling data from a 12-bay rackmount RAID over 10GbE with read speeds in the 900MB/s range.
